ABSTRACT Race to the Future is an exciting and dynamic activity modeled
after the reality television show The Amazing Race. It exemplifies how 21st century
skills can be incorporated into core subject instruction and at the same
time positively enhance student engagement. In this activity, students work
quickly and cooperatively with their teammates and use 21st century skills to
successfully decipher five clues related to science content. We have used this
activity with excellent results with different groups of students (middle school,
high school, and university students), for different purposes (ice-breaker, teambuilding,
course assessment, and evaluation), and in broad curriculum areas
(science and math). However, the activity is especially powerful when introduced
during the first day or week of class. The meaningful and enjoyable
student collaboration, the upbeat class environment, and the enhanced student
engagement achieved at the conclusion of this challenging activity set an
optimal teaching and learning environment for the entire quarter/semester
